Moving activity: I had students stand up and touch something made of…, touch something used for… around the classroom, then the students were the teacher and told me and others what to touch. Example: touch something made of plastic, touch something used for reading.

Whisper game: As a vocabulary review we played whisper, age where there are two teams lined up to the back of the classroom. I gave each team a vocabulary word which they whispered down the line of their classmates to the final person who ran and hit the corresponding vocabulary photo.
